Hyderabad police plan to increase drunken drive checks to eradicate road accidents

Police conducted a drunken drive check in Jubilee Hills and Banjara Hills areas of Hyderabad on Saturday following which 61 people were identified as drunk.

28 cars and 33 two-wheelers were caught by the police who stated that their license will be canceled if they are drunk driving again.

Four women were caught in the drunken drive check including an Army Major’s wife who refused to co-operate with the police in conducting breathe analyzer test initially.

Later, police tested her and filed a case against her.

Police are planning to increase these checks in order to curb road accidents.
